Our LYZD-GJL2500 model achieves a production output of 13 cages per 10-hour shift, processing cage diameters from φ700–φ2500 mm and lengths up to 12 meters. With fully automatic PLC control and dual spiral bar configurations, this system reduces labor requirements to just 1 operator while maintaining welding pitch accuracy within ±1mm—critical for bridge foundations, deep pile works, and precast concrete manufacturing where structural integrity cannot be compromised.

The system handles main bar diameters from φ18–φ40 mm and spiral bars from φ8–φ16 mm. This flexibility means you can serve multiple project specifications without investing in separate machines.
| Parameter | Value |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Model | LYZD-GJL2500 | — |
| Cage Diameter Range | φ700–φ2500 mm | Adjustable welding disc |
| Cage Length Capacity | Up to 12 m | Single-section output |
| Main Bar Diameter | φ18–φ40 mm | High-tensile rebar compatible |
| Spiral Bar Diameter | φ8–φ16 mm | Single/double spiral options |
| Spiral Bar Spacing | ≤300 mm | Precision pitch control |
| Hydraulic Pressure | ≤16 MPa | Stable clamping force |
| Air Supply Pressure | ≤0.8 MPa | Standard compressor compatible |
| Total System Power | 30 kW | Welding power: 100 kW |
| Operating Personnel | 1 person | Minimal training required |
| Production Efficiency | 13 cages / 10 hrs | 12-meter sections |
| Footprint | 30 m × 8.5 m | Compact layout design |
| Power Supply | 380V / 50Hz / 3-phase | Custom configurations available |
| Control System | PLC + HMI touchscreen | Intuitive interface |

You begin by loading main bars and spiral wire onto the feeding system. The PLC reads your input specifications from the touchscreen: cage diameter, length, spiral pitch, and bar quantities.
The machine automatically positions the main bars in the welding disc arrangement. Spiral wire feeds from the motorized spool as the cage rotates. Welding heads move along the frame, applying precise heat and pressure at each intersection point.
The completed cage exits the production zone once the final weld cools. Your operator performs a visual quality check before the next cycle begins. The entire sequence runs with minimal manual touchpoints.
Q: How does the machine adjust for different cage diameters?
A: The system uses adjustable welding discs and HMI-programmed presets. You can reposition components mechanically for major changes or select stored diameter settings for rapid automated adjustments via the PLC.
Q: Can the machine weld both ribbed and smooth rebar?
A: Yes. Welding pressure and current are adjustable through the inverter controls. This accommodates various surface profiles while maintaining weld integrity across different rebar grades.
Q: What is the typical maintenance cycle for welding electrodes?
A: You should dress electrodes every shift to maintain optimal contact. Full replacement occurs every 500-1000 cages depending on wire gauge and current settings used during production runs.
Q: How does the machine handle voltage fluctuations on-site?
A: The LYZD-GJL2500 incorporates automatic voltage stabilization and power filters. These protect the PLC and ensure welding consistency even in environments with unstable electrical supply.
